301 - A WRECKER OR A BUILDER
I WATCHED them tear a building down,
A crew of men in a busy town ;
With a ho and a heave and a lusty
They swung a beam and down the wall fell.
I asked the foreman, "Are these men skilled ?
The kind you would hire if you would build ?"
The foreman replied, "Why, no, indeed !
Common laborers are all I need,
For they can wreck in a day or two
That which has taken years to do."
So I asked myself as I went on my way,
"What part in the game of life do you play ?
Are you shaping your life to a well-made plan,
Patiently doing the best that you can ?
Or are you a wrecker that walks the town,
Content with the pleasure of tearing down ?"
